MySQL数据库DDL建表语句详解

需积分: 50 3 下载量 102 浏览量 更新于2024-08-26 收藏 6.01MB PPT 举报
"DDL建表语句是MySQL数据库中用于创建数据表的关键语法,它定义了数据表的结构,包括列、数据类型以及存储机制。创建表的基本语法是`CREATE TABLE [schema.] table (column datatype[DEFAULT expr], ...) ENGINE = 存储机制`。在表的定义中,每条记录由一列或多列组成,每个列称为字段,而主键列是一个独特的字段,用于唯一标识每条记录。MySQL是一种广泛使用的开源关系型数据库管理系统,以其性能高效、跨平台支持、简单易用和开源等特性受到青睐。 MySQL的特点包括: 1. 单进程多线程:允许在同一时间处理多个请求。 2. 支持多用户:允许多个用户同时访问和操作数据库。 3. 客户机/服务器架构:通信发生在客户端应用程序和服务器之间。 4. 开源:源代码开放,允许自由分发和修改。 5. 性能高效:在处理大量数据时表现优秀。 6. 跨平台支持:可以在不同的操作系统上运行,如Windows、Linux等。 7. 简单易用:学习曲线相对平缓,适合初学者。 安装MySQL数据库的步骤大致如下: 1. 访问MySQL官方网站下载对应系统的安装包。 2. 双击安装文件,按照向导完成安装,确保安装过程中选择合适的版本(32位或64位)。 3. 安装完成后,在Windows开始菜单中找到MySQL的相关程序,如MySQL CommandLine Client,用于启动命令行界面。 启动和管理MySQL服务可以通过Windows的服务管理器或命令行进行: - 在服务管理器中查看和操作MySQL服务,如启动、停止。 - 在命令行下,使用`net start`和`net stop`命令配合MySQL服务名来启动和停止服务。 配置MySQL服务通常涉及到修改`my.ini`文件,该文件包含各种参数选项,每个选项组以方括号`[]`标识,参数遵循`参数名=参数值`的格式,注意参数名的大小写敏感性。这些参数可以调整数据库的行为,比如内存使用、日志设置等。 此外,MySQL数据库还支持多种SQL语句,包括DML(Data Manipulation Language)和DDL(Data Definition Language)。DML语句用于插入、更新和删除数据,如`INSERT`, `UPDATE`, `DELETE`;DDL语句用于创建、修改和删除数据库对象,如`CREATE TABLE`, `ALTER TABLE`, `DROP TABLE`等。在数据库设计中,合理运用DDL语句可以构建出满足需求的数据表结构,从而有效地存储和管理数据。"